Angry Support of AIX 4.3.3 beyond the 31/12/04


Hi,

We are currently running Oracle Applications 11.0.3 under AIX 4.3.3. This version of OA is not supported to run under 5L and as we really don't wish to upgrade to OA 11i, the annoucement of the end of support AIX 4.3.3 by IBM is pretty much of a very bad news to us.
Does anyone know of any company that would offer an alternative ES support for AIX 4.3.3 ?

IBM will continue to support AIX 4.3.3 if you have a support contract with them. Just contact your IBM support and ask them for support and pricing.
